Abstract

Abstract From the reaction between W 2 (NMe 2) 6 and dimesitylborinic acid,(Mes) 2 BOH (2 equiv.), in toluene, the golden-yellow crystalline compound W 2 (NMe 2) 4 [OB (Mes) 2] 2 (1) has been isolated and characterized (elemental analysis, 1 H, 13 C {1 H}, 11 B NMR spectroscopy, IR spectroscopy and a single crystal X-ray diffraction study). At− 160 C, a= 39.379 (7), b= 13.649 (2), c= 21.918 (4) Å, β= 123.12 (1), Z= 8 and space group C2/c. The ...
